.content-container[class]{
    position:relative;
    z-index:100;	
    padding:0;
	background: url(/inc/images/category_bc.png) repeat-y !important;
}
.left{    
    float:left;
    width:176px;
    background:url(/inc/images/shopby_bc.gif) no-repeat top;
    padding:35px 0 0 0;
}

.leftnews{    
    float:left;
    width:176px;
    background:url(/inc/images/archives.gif) no-repeat top;
    padding:70px 0 0 0;
}

.guideleft{    
    float:left;
    width:176px;
    background:url(/inc/images/guide_bc.gif) no-repeat top;
    padding:35px 0 0 0;
}

.infoleft{    
    float:left;
    width:176px;
    padding:35px 0 0 0;
}
.right{
    float:right;
    width:784px;    
}
.banner{
    width:784px;
    height:214px;    
    position:relative;
    z-index:-1;    
}
.content-left{
    position:relative;
    z-index:-1;
    float:left;    
    width:644px;
    border-right:1px solid #E2DFDD;
	z-index:9999;
}
.content-right{
    float:left;
    width:129px;
    padding:15px 0 15px 10px;
}
.best-sellers{
    width:621px;
    margin:0 0 0 3px;
    background: url(/inc/images/head_bc.gif) repeat-x;    
    padding:17px 0 15px 20px;
}
.best-sellers ul{padding:4px 0 0 0;}
.best-sellers ul li{
    float:left;
    width:130px;
    padding:0 25px 12px 0;
}
.best-sellers ul li a{/*white-space:nowrap;*/}
.best-sellers ul li img{border:1px solid #E9E8E8;margin:0 0 5px 0;}

.category-bottom{
    border-top:1px solid #E2DFDD;
    background:url(/inc/images/cat_btm_bc.gif) repeat-x;
    width:621px;
    margin:0 0 0 3px;
    padding:17px 0 15px 20px;
}

.buying_guides{
    border-top:1px solid #E2DFDD;
	border-bottom:1px solid #E2DFDD;
    background:url(/inc/images/cat_btm_bc.gif) repeat-x;
    width:621px;
    margin:0 0 0 3px;
    padding:17px 0 15px 20px;
}


.category-bottom-left{
    float:left;
    width:159px;
}
.category-bottom-center{
    float:left;
    width:157px;
}
.category-bottom-right{
    float:left;
    width:287px;
}
a.free-shipping{
    display:block;
    text-indent: -9999px;
    background:url(/inc/images/buttons/free_shipping.gif) no-repeat;
    width:287px;
    height:47px;
    margin:0 0 10px 0;
}

a.free-ship-fans{
    display:block;
    text-indent: -9999px;
    background:url(/inc/images/buttons/freeshipfans.gif) no-repeat;
    width:287px;
    height:47px;
    margin:0 0 10px 0;
}

ul.top-brands{padding:15px 0 0 8px;}
ul.top-brands li{padding:0 0 19px 0;}